Incident date

November 17, 2015

Incident Code

RS160

LOCATION

الباب, Al Bab, Aleppo, Syria

The VDC and Aleppo Eyewitness reported that two named non-combatant men were killed in an alleged Russian airstrike in Al Bab. However, Syrian Martyrs and the Damascus Centre for Human Rights blamed the Assad regime. Other sources simply blamed ‘warplanes.’

Incident date

November 17, 2015

Incident Code

RS157

LOCATION

حريتان, Hraytan, Aleppo, Syria

A 27-year old civilian male named reported killed in Hraytan following a Russian or Assad regime airstrike. Seven civilians were additionally said to have been injured. While Halab News and Hraytan’s residents blamed the attack on Russia, the VDC said Mr Qinti died as a result of a regime airstrike (“air forces shelling.”)

بينين, Benin, Idlib, Syria

Up to four non-combatants, including two children, were killed and 10 injured in alleged Russian nighttime airstrikes on Benin. The Syrian Network for Human Rights stated that phosphorous weapons may have been used in two strikes, which burned 500m of agricultural land. Additional strikes then targeted an olive pressing facility and a bakery in Bayneen.
